Hey release folks — quick heads up on Splitgate, our experiment assignment service. We're shipping the fix for the sticky-bucketing drift that Marisol flagged last week, plus a small perf win on the hashing path (about 12% faster assignments under load). Rollout goes canary-first in the Tarnville cluster Tuesday morning, full fleet by Thursday if error rates stay flat. Please hold any config pushes to the assignment layer until canary clears. Questions to the weekly sync thread. The candidate build is pinned below.

trace token, fafog-kageg: htk4_98e6

Heads up, team: FormulaPond's sandbox for user-supplied formulas is tripping alerts again. A customer pasted a nested macro that blew past the evaluation depth limit, and the sandbox killed it mid-run, so they saw a generic "calculation failed" error. That's expected behavior, not a bug — the guard is doing its job. If customers call in about formulas suddenly failing, explain the depth limit and suggest they flatten their expressions. The tuning knobs and current limits are documented on the internal page below.

dashboard of tahop-fahof = https://harbor.tolvaqnet.example/secrets/merge_requests/board/issue/merge_requests/pipeline/secrets/ecb30ed86a55c001a77f6cb9

- [ ] Sweeper check (Driftmoor ceremony). Before we seal the new keys, run the orphaned-resource sweeper one last time so it doesn't reap the fresh HSM partitions — yes, it's happened. Tag anything it flags as ceremony-protected. When the sweep comes back clean, the witness records the recovery passphrase shown on the next line.

vault phrase of yagag-kadup = belael-druius-rusax-kelox